We understand that you're going through a challenging time as you feel threatened by your beloved's ex returning to the picture. First, we commend you for ending your prayer in Jesus' name, as it is only by His name that we have access to God the Father, and we implore all to call on Jesus as their Lord and Savior.

Let's remember the wonderful and divine way that God's word talks about love. Love is the greatest virtue. It is the mark of a true Christian. God is love, and since we are His children through faith in Jesus, we must love even those who do not love us. We must love our enemies. We must pray for them and bless them. This is how God blesses us.

In this passage in Philippians 4:6-7, it says: "In nothing be anxious, but in everything, by prayer and petition with thanksgiving, let your requests be made known to God. And the peace of God, which surpasses all understanding, will guard your hearts and your thoughts in Christ Jesus," This means that God is our only comforter and peace giver. Matthew 6:25-34 also tells us that God is aware of our needs and will provide for us. He clothes the grass of the field, which is here today and tomorrow is thrown into the fire, will he not much more clothe you? So do not worry about tomorrow; for tomorrow will care for itself. Each day has enough trouble of its own.

We have confidence in knowing that no one can interfere with God's plan for you and your beloved. Trust in the Lord with all your heart, and do not lean on your own understanding. In all your ways acknowledge him, and he will make straight your paths (Proverbs 3:5,6). Continue to be loving, patient, kind, and understanding. Let us remember how Ephesians 4:2-3 says:

with all humility and gentleness, with patience, bearing with one another in love, eager to maintain the unity of the Spirit in the bond of peace.

Let us also pray:

Heavenly Father, we come before you today to lift up our sister who is experiencing heartache and worry. We ask that You grant her Your peace that surpasses all understanding. Help her to trust in You and Your plan for her life and her relationship. We pray that her beloved remains committed to marriage and that God's will be done. Give her the strength to love, to be patient, kind, understanding, and wise, and to be a light to all around her as she waits on You. In Jesus' name, we pray. Amen.

Dear sister, continue to pray for your beloved and even his ex that both of them will do the will of God. Pray that your hearts will be drawn closer to God and to each other as you wait patiently for God's perfect timing. Keep your eyes on Jesus, the author and finisher of our faith.

We're here with you, feeling your anxiety as your beloved's ex re-enters the picture. It's natural to feel worried, but remember, God is always in control. Let's cling to His promise in Psalm 147:3, "He heals the brokenhearted and binds up their wounds." Trust that He's mending your heart, even when you can't feel it.

Let's also remember Matthew 6:26, "Look at the birds of the air; they do not sow or reap or store away in barns, and yet your heavenly Father feeds them. Are you not much more valuable than they?" God cares for you deeply, and He won't let you down.

Let's pray together: Heavenly Father, we ask for Your comfort and healing for our ###. Help her to trust in Your unfailing love. Guide her beloved and give him the strength to stand firm in his commitment. Bind up her wounds, Lord, and help her to find peace in Your embrace. In Jesus' name, we pray. Amen.
